Forget store-bought cheese—this incredibly easy, fresh homemade cheese requires just two ingredients and 5 minutes of your time! By adding vinegar to milk, you’ll get a mild, creamy, and versatile cheese perfect for salads, spreads, or even paneer-style dishes.

Ingredients & Tools
What You Need:
4 cups whole milk (not ultra-pasteurized)
2 tbsp white vinegar (or lemon juice)
½ tsp salt (optional, for flavor)
Optional Add-Ins:
Herbs (dill, chives, garlic powder)
Red pepper flakes
Black pepper
